Point Of Pay joins PCI


 

Point Of Pay joins PCI Security Standards Council as newest Participating Organization

 

—Point Of Pay to participate in key standards setting body protecting payment cardholder data—

Melbourne, Victoria/Australia, December 5, 2008 — Point Of Pay Pty Ltd, the developer of the Point of Pay (PoP) technology, announced today that it has joined the PCI Security Standards Council as a new participating organization.  As a Participating Organization, Point Of Pay will work with the Council to evolve the PCI Data Security Standard (DSS) and other payment card data protection standards. 

 

The PCI DSS, endorsed by American Express, Discover Financial Services, JCB International, MasterCard Worldwide and Visa Inc., requires merchants and service providers that store, process or transmit customer payment card data to adhere to information security controls and processes that ensure data integrity.  More information on the council and the standard can be found at www.pcisecuritystandards.org

 

As a Participating Organization, Point Of Pay will now have access to the latest payment card security standards from the Council, be able to provide feedback on the standards and become part of a growing community that now includes more than 490 organizations. In an era of increasingly sophisticated attacks on systems, adhering to the PCI DSS represents an entity’s best protection against data criminals.  By joining as a Participating Organization, Point Of Pay, is adding its voice to the process.

 

“The PCI Security Standards Council is committed to helping everyone involved in the payment chain to protect consumer payment data,” said Bob Russo, General Manager of the PCI Security Standards Council. “By participating in the standards setting process, Point Of Pay demonstrates they are playing an active part in this important end goal.”

 

“PoP represents, for the first time anywhere in the world, an ATM / EFTPOS-level secure way to transact online from home or the office, with these transactions being accepted as cardholder present (CHP) transactions at all times.

 

We look forward to being an active participant on the PCI Security Standards Council,” said Daniel Elbaum, Chairman and CEO of Point Of Pay.

About Point Of Pay Pty Ltd

 

Point Of Pay is the developer of the Point of Pay (PoP) technology; a technology enabling card holder present (CHP) transactions over the Internet, thus preventing online identity fraud. That is, PoP enables simple and secure (EFTPOS / ATM level) on-line purchasing, on-line banking and on-line bill payments from home or business.
